I was taught to put the glove on and apply pressure to the simulated cut, and then disinfect, then add the bandage over the simulated cut while the glove is still on. Is that correct for 2022 blood exposure procedure?
@zilkits476
2 жыл бұрын
Hey Michelle, thank you for commenting. You want to follow the procedure steps in order that are outlined in the PSI Handbook. Those are... 1. Wears gloves 2. Apply pressure to the cut to stop bleeding 3. Cleanses simulated cut 4. Bandage simulated cut 5. Properly disposes used materials 6. Properly disposes used implements 7. Sanitizes hands using a product labeled as hand sanitizer You could put one glove on one hand and do the simulated cut on the non dom. or you can put gloves on both hands and do it over the glove. Either way wouldnt lose points.
